Anime Heroes Surpass Goal for Aussie Wildlife

By Josh PiedraMarch 4, 2020

Last month, we reported the Crunchyroll was teaming up with the anime community to raise money to help Australia’s wildlife during the crisis of the Australian fires. Through GoFundMe, Anime Heroes of Aussie Wildlife set a goal of $150,000 AUD.

Today, Crunchyroll announced that they have surpassed that goal!

Anime Heroes of Aussie Wildlife raised over $190,000 AUD (~$125,305 USD)!

344 donors from the Crunchyroll community forces with AnimeLab, Funimation, Madman Entertainment, Wakarim Aniplex, and many more to make this goal a reality. All of this was accomplished in just under 2 months! The donations will go directly to Wildlife Victoria — a not-for-profit organization, offering an emergency response service to the community to help with sick, injured, or orphaned wildlife.

Thank you to everyone who donated and helped support the cause! Crunchyroll is also incredibly thankful for the community members that donated to the wildlife in Australia. Although the fires have eased, the damage impacted 1 billion animals across over 7 million hectares. We’re hopeful that these funds will provide some relief to those impacted by the fire.
